Several key factors are driving the expansion of the polyethylene powder coating market. Firstly, the inherent properties of PE powder coatings, including their excellent flexibility, durability, and chemical resistance, make them ideal for a wide range of applications. This versatility is a significant advantage over competing coating technologies. Secondly, environmental concerns are pushing a shift towards lower-VOC coatings, and PE powder coatings align perfectly with this trend, contributing to cleaner manufacturing processes and reduced environmental impact. The increasing demand for sustainable products in construction, transportation, and other industries further boosts the adoption of these eco-friendly coatings. Thirdly, the cost-effectiveness of PE powder coatings compared to other alternatives makes them attractive to manufacturers seeking to optimize production costs without sacrificing quality. This price advantage is particularly significant in high-volume manufacturing scenarios. Finally, ongoing technological advancements are continuously improving the performance characteristics of PE powder coatings, leading to enhanced durability, color retention, and overall aesthetic appeal. This evolution makes them increasingly competitive in demanding applications, furthering their market penetration across diverse sectors.
Despite the promising outlook, several challenges and restraints could impede the growth of the polyethylene powder coating market. One major challenge is the relatively lower gloss and color intensity compared to some other coating technologies. This limitation can be a drawback for certain applications that require a high-gloss finish or vibrant colors. Another challenge lies in the potential for degradation of the coating under prolonged exposure to UV radiation, particularly in exterior applications. This necessitates the development of specialized UV-resistant formulations to enhance the longevity of the coating. Furthermore, the application process of PE powder coatings can be complex, requiring specialized equipment and expertise. This can present a barrier to entry for smaller manufacturers and potentially increase production costs. Lastly, fluctuating raw material prices, especially for polyethylene resin, can affect the overall cost competitiveness of these coatings and introduce uncertainty for manufacturers. Addressing these challenges through continuous innovation and technological advancements will be crucial for sustained growth in the market.
The Asia-Pacific region is projected to dominate the polyethylene powder coating market during the forecast period (2025-2033). This dominance is largely attributable to the rapid industrialization and urbanization in countries like China and India, leading to a significant surge in demand for construction materials and electric appliances. Within the Asia-Pacific region, China is expected to be the leading market, propelled by its robust infrastructure development projects and expanding manufacturing base.
In summary, the combination of strong economic growth, increasing urbanization, and a rising demand for durable, cost-effective, and environmentally friendly coatings in the construction and electric appliance sectors positions the Asia-Pacific region, particularly China, as the leading market for polyethylene powder coatings.
